Running FC4.  Don't think this is specifically a Fedora issue but I know 
this is where the brains are ;)

I recently added some AirLink 10/100/1000 network cards with the RealTek 
8169 chips.  They appear to function well with the exception of one 
_very_ annoying trait.  If there is no carrier, i.e. no cable attached 
or the other end of the cable is down, they spew:

     ethX: r8169: PHY reset until link up".

This is not a problem in runlevel 5, but in lesser runlevels this is 
output directly to the console every few seconds, more or less making 
the console useless for a workspace.

I've tried redirecting output to /dev/null in /etc/modprobe.conf but 
that didn't do anything or I didn't do it correctly.

Does anybody know how to silence these beasts, or at least to direct 
their plaints to the bit bucket?
